YieldReaction ConditionsOperation in experiment
90%
Stage #1: With hydrazine In ethanol at 85℃; for 15 h;
Stage #2: With acetone In ethanol at 2℃; for 2 h;
Intermediate 77 (Stage 2) <n="116"/>4-[4-chlorophenyl]methyl}-1(2H)-phthalazinone(3.pound.)-3-[(4-Chlorophenyl)methyhdene]-2-benzofuran-1 (3H)-one (as prepared, for example, in stage 1) (1 0 eq, corrected for loss on drying) is suspended in EtOH (3 7 vol) and heated to approximately 85 0C at slight reflux A solution of hydrazine hydrate (commercially available, for example, from Aldrich) (1 2 eq) in EtOH (O 63 vol) is added through a dropping funnel over 1 h At the end of the addition, EtOH (0 63 vol) is added through the dropping funnel into the reaction suspension in order to remove traces of hydrazine hydrate The reaction suspension is heated at approximately 85 0C at slight reflux for 14 h It is cooled to approximately 20 0C and a sample is taken to check the conversion (99percent conversion, HPLC) Acetone (0 35 vol) is added to the reaction mixture over 30 mm (exothermic reaction) The quenched suspension is stirred for at least 1 h and is then cooled to approximately 2 0C over 30 mm and stirred at approximately 2 0C for 1 h The product is isolated by filtration through a suction strainer and is washed with cold EtOH (approximately 0-5 0C, 3 x 1 9 vol) The pale brown solid is completely dried on the suction strainer in vacuo under nitrogen The title compound is obtained as a pale brown solid Yield (corrected for 1H NMR assay) 90-95percent1H MMR (400MHz, DMSO-Cf6), δ 4 30 (s, 2H), 7 35 (m, 4H), 7 88 (m, 3H), 8 26 (d, 1 H), 12 62 (s, 1 H)
Reference: [1] Patent: WO2007/122156, 2007, A1, . Location in patent: Page/Page column 114-115
